An official from El Feel oilfield said Monday that the oil crude reached 60 thousand barrels per day, after resuming production in the field, according to Reuters.

The source added that the employees at the field are now working to refill the tanks with crude oil to resume the export process following the recent closure of the field.

The Libyan National Oil Corporation (NOC) announced on June 12 the lifting of force majeure on El Feel oilfield after its closure since last February over disagreements with the Petroleum Facilities Guard.
